Output 3012c7768391fc0db35beaaba1213ae8dc66f83e20038ad8fca218fbb5982c3d:1

value
591630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c188643f413a075faae1b82e0ce35b4a55f6aa3 OP_EQUAL
address
3Mkmxjgr5cdKw5vwsSCgXphseTySp8LGcY
transaction
3012c7768391fc0db35beaaba1213ae8dc66f83e20038ad8fca218fbb5982c3d
confirmations
170818
spent
true